This document is the results of an eight-month investigative study on the proposed:
Paradise of the Sea project, on the El Mogote Peninsula in La Paz, B.C.S., Mexico
Paradise of the Sea, or the Destruction of Paradise?
Concerned Citizens has undertaken this exhaustive investigative study so that all of the genuine impacts: ecological, cultural, social, economical, standard(s) of living, resource uses, legal implications, etc. can be presented and clearly understood by all citizens and visitors concerned with the future of La Paz.
This is a summary of the 254 megabyte study we have compiled from: a myriad of highly competent investigators reports/studies; five universities (including three of La Paz? finest) studies of the various impacts; numerous public officials personal assistance and public documents; world renowned N.G.O.s; National and International Governmental reports on applicable topics; the efforts of a multitude of concerned citizens, etc.
We have tried to present this document in plain and easy to understand language so that all people are informed in terms they can easily comprehend. Concerned Citizens approaches this as a project that will educate the people so that they can formulate their opinions from a well-informed standpoint and take actions based upon those well-informed opinions.
The complete scientific, and all related, studies are available to those who wish to study the in-depth implications of all of the topics at hand and formulate their own opinions.
